Asadabad District

It includes the city of Asadabad - the district center, close the Kunar River.

It has 12 big and small villages, which are surrounded by mountains so there is not enough land for farming.

[3] The district has serious issues with flooding, which destroys large amounts of agricultural land.

[3] Asadabad district produces wheat, rice, sugarcane and vegetable.

[3] Common livestock include goats, cows, sheep and buffalos, with oxen used for labor.
